Abstract
Since the colliding pulse mode-locking CPM) technique and the intercavity group-velocity dispersion (GVD) compensation have been used in the generation of ultrashort pulses,the optical pulses generated from mode-locked dye lasers have been reduced to the femtosecond region.MA By using these techniques, pulses of about 30-fs can be obtained, but usually employing a ring cavity and with a four Brewster- angled-prism GVD compensator in it. The laser system is more complex and it is not easy to adjust it reaching optimum condition.
